After I got out of college and got a job and a place of my own where I could dress as I desired I bought my first set of breastforms. Like a lot of girls I went big, D cup. I thought that big breasts made you more feminine, I quickly found out otherwise. It was tough to find clothes that right and they were always in the way. I went like that for a couple of years but soon figured out most women are a B or a C cup and if I wanted to look more natural I had to downsize. I still have those D cup forms in a bottom drawer but haven't worn them in years. Now I am a very comfortable ad happy 36B and feel that I am feminine and more mainstream!

When going out, it is different. For me anyway, as my primary goal is to (try to) pass. Too big and you are noticed. Too small you are noticed.
I don't like the really big boobs when out (d or larger); mostly because nothing really fits. The unintended brush or bump happens too much for my taste. You even have to be careful sitting at a table. Interestingly, when those distractions are not present, I really am unaware of them at all - after a while, anyway.
So, I have a skeleton only a fullback could love; broad shoulders, large rib cage. An A gets lost; depending on what I try to put on even a B looks inadequate. So what is left is a C, which seems to work best, it puts me at about 1/2 on the elbow test.
More important (when trying to pass) is waist, hips, and derriere. Portraying an X rather and Y silhouette takes more of my attention; and is harder to accomplish. The breast size is the easiest to deal with.
Bottom line: Brest size really doesn't matter, looking good (right?) is important.

Ok I have been holding off on this but time to chime in. I originally had enhancers which made me a 38a or b. I was alot lighter than and they looked perportional to my body shape. I later picked up some forms at a store close out which moved me up to 38c. As i gained weight they started to look small and I added the enhancers to make them a bit more perportional to my body. I continued to gain weight and what I had began to look small so I began to look for something new. My ex was in one of her mental abusive modes and one thing she said stuck "You will never know what it is like to have big boobs". So I got some cheapy 40DD's so I could be comparable to her 38DD's. No I could never completely know what it is like but I could feel a part of what it would be like. I felt the weight, the tired back, the sweat, them getting in the way. Try framing a wall then trying to walk between the studs, opps need to pull them in. They are always bumping into something. I never thought I would wear them out and about, But as much as they were a pain, they were comfortable and me. Also I had gained some more weight, so they did not look huge on me but just a little big. After a little more weight gain I did wear them out and they looked ok and perportional on me. And interestingly the area I live in has alot of plus sized gals so I just fit in.
Well my DD's are starting to show wear so I look into getting another pair and get a new set of forms 40DD full figure. They are fuller sized and less perky and I really like those and they fit my full figure bras better also. They also look more realisti for a person my age. We my cheapy 4DD's go so I make due with my other ones for a while but quickly see they are showing wear as I am wearing them most nights and some weekends all weekend. So I get another pair of the cheapy 40DD's from the same place I did last time. I figured they lasted me 4 years they were ok for cheapy. But I did not read the whole discription that says they have a new supplier and they run larger until after I get them. So now i have a pair of perky 40DDD's. That is ok i got to do some more shopping for bras.
I have yet to wear these new ones out as the size is ok but I think they are a bit too perky for my size and age. They work well for around the house.
So I guess my moral is, make sure they are perportional to your size and look right on you. If you are more fluffy, you can wear a larger form and look perportional. But this does not mean you have to. In watching gals when I am out and about gals and breat size are all over the map. Little gals with small breast, little gals with big breast, big gals with big breast, and big gals with small breast. But normally gals are average and perportional. Look for gals that are your size and build and look for their average breast size and that is the area you should be wearing for form size if you want to blend in. If you do not care if you blend in then wear what you want as there are gals out there that size.
I know I have always tried to look perportional. When ever i begin to loose some weight my form size will also follow.
